SHIJA felicitates blood donor organizers

    31-Oct-2025
|
Imphal, Oct 30 : In observance of National Blood Donation Day, a felicitation programme for blood donor organizers was held at Shija Auditorium, Langol on October 30.
The event was organized by Shija Blood Centre & Transfusion Services, a unit of Shija Foundation, and sponsored by the State Blood Transfusion Council (SBTC), Manipur, and Shija Hospitals. The theme for this year was “Give Blood, Give Hope: Together We Save Lives.”
Dr Palin Khundongbam, CMD, Shija Hospitals, graced the event as the chief guest with Dr H Teresa, Director, SBTC, Manipur as the guest of honour and Dr Chetan Khundongbam, Secretary, Shija Foundation as the functional president.
More than 70 individuals attended, including 24 blood donor organizers from across the State.
Dr C Rajmani Singh, Medical Officer-in-charge, Shija Blood Centre & Transfusion Services, delivered the welcome and keynote address, acknowledging the contribution of blood donor organizers and encouraging sustained voluntary blood donation.
Dr Teresa shared that National Blood Donation Day was first observed in 1975 and in Manipur since 1998.
She noted that private blood centers contribute one-fourth of the State’s total blood collection and called blood donors “silent and unrecognized heroes.”
As per 2024 data, Manipur has achieved 30% voluntary blood donation, with a goal to reach 100%.
Meanwhile, Dr Palin highlighted that Shija Blood Centre was the first in Manipur to introduce apheresis, with single donor platelets proving lifesaving during dengue outbreaks.
At the event, blood donor organizers were felicitated with mementos and certificates.
Dr Chetan Khundongbam described them as “guardian angels,” and the vote of thanks was proposed by Dr Hemabati Salam, Consultant, Transfusion Medicine.
